Study Computer Science Abroad: Expand Your Horizons and Master Your Skills

Study Computer Science Abroad: Expand Your Horizons and Master Your Skills
Study Computer Science Abroad: Expand Your Horizons and Master Your Skills

Are you a computer science enthusiast looking to take your skills to the next level? Look no further than studying computer science abroad! Embarking on this educational journey not only provides you with the opportunity to immerse yourself in a new culture but also offers a unique perspective on the field of computer science. In this blog article, we will delve into the benefits of studying computer science abroad, explore the various destinations that offer exceptional programs, and provide you with tips to make the most out of your experience.

Studying computer science abroad opens doors to a plethora of benefits. From gaining a global perspective on technological advancements to enhancing your intercultural communication skills, this section will discuss the advantages of pursuing your computer science studies in a foreign country.

Table of Contents

1. Expanding Your Global Perspective

Studying computer science abroad allows you to broaden your horizons by exposing you to different cultures, perspectives, and technological advancements. By immersing yourself in a new environment, you gain a deeper understanding of how computer science is applied in different parts of the world. This exposure fosters creativity and innovative thinking, enabling you to approach problem-solving from diverse angles.

2. Enhancing Intercultural Communication Skills

Effective communication is a crucial skill in the field of computer science. Studying abroad provides you with an excellent opportunity to immerse yourself in a foreign language and culture, improving your intercultural communication skills. Interacting with local students and professionals not only enhances your language proficiency but also helps you develop cross-cultural collaboration skills, essential in today’s globalized tech industry.

3. Access to Cutting-Edge Research and Resources

Many renowned universities abroad are at the forefront of computer science research and innovation. By studying computer science abroad, you gain access to state-of-the-art facilities, cutting-edge research projects, and renowned professors who are leading experts in their fields. This exposure allows you to stay updated with the latest advancements and technologies, giving you a competitive edge in your future career.

4. Diversifying Your Skill Set

Studying abroad exposes you to different teaching methods and curriculum structures. This diversity enhances your learning experience by introducing you to new programming languages, frameworks, and problem-solving techniques. Additionally, you may have the opportunity to take elective courses that are not available in your home country, allowing you to diversify your skill set and explore new areas of interest within computer science.

5. Building a Global Network

Studying computer science abroad allows you to build a global network of peers, professors, and professionals in the field. Collaborating with students from different countries fosters cross-cultural understanding and opens doors for future collaborations and international job opportunities. Networking events, hackathons, and conferences organized by universities abroad provide platforms for you to connect with industry leaders and build valuable relationships.

Top Destinations for Studying Computer Science Abroad

Discover the best destinations around the world that offer outstanding computer science programs. From renowned universities in the United States to emerging tech hubs in Europe and Asia, we will highlight the countries and institutions that are at the forefront of computer science education.

READ :  Funniest Computer Names: Hilarious Monikers That Will Make You LOL

1. United States: Silicon Valley and Beyond

The United States is home to some of the world’s most prestigious universities and tech companies. Silicon Valley, located in California, is renowned for its innovation and entrepreneurial spirit. Universities such as Stanford, MIT, and Carnegie Mellon offer exceptional computer science programs and have strong ties to the industry. Studying computer science in the United States provides you with access to a dynamic tech ecosystem and abundant internship and job opportunities.

2. Canada: Leading the Way in Artificial Intelligence

Canada has emerged as a global leader in artificial intelligence (AI) research and development. Universities like the University of Toronto and McGill University have renowned computer science departments that focus on AI and machine learning. Studying computer science in Canada exposes you to cutting-edge AI research and a supportive tech community, making it an ideal destination for those interested in AI and related fields.

3. United Kingdom: Excellence in Computer Science Education

The United Kingdom is known for its world-class education system, including computer science programs. Institutions like the University of Oxford, Imperial College London, and the University of Cambridge offer rigorous computer science curricula and have a long-standing reputation for excellence. Studying computer science in the UK provides you with a solid foundation in theoretical and practical aspects of the field.

4. Germany: A Haven for Engineering and Technology

Germany is renowned for its engineering and technological prowess. With universities like the Technical University of Munich and the University of Stuttgart, Germany offers exceptional computer science programs that emphasize practical applications and industry collaborations. The country’s strong emphasis on research and innovation makes it an attractive destination for those seeking hands-on experience and exposure to cutting-edge technologies.

5. Australia: Innovation Down Under

Australia is emerging as a vibrant destination for computer science studies. Universities such as the University of Melbourne and the Australian National University offer comprehensive computer science programs with a focus on innovation and entrepreneurship. Australia’s multicultural society and thriving tech start-up scene provide a unique environment for computer science students to learn and grow.

Navigating the Application Process

Applying to study computer science abroad can be a daunting task. This section will guide you through the application process, including important documents, requirements, and tips for securing admission to your dream computer science program.

1. Researching and Shortlisting Universities

Start by researching universities that offer computer science programs aligned with your interests and career goals. Consider factors such as the curriculum, faculty expertise, research opportunities, and the overall reputation of the institution. Shortlist a few universities that you find most appealing and align with your academic aspirations.

2. Meeting Admission Requirements

Each university has its own set of admission requirements for computer science programs. These typically include academic transcripts, standardized test scores (such as the SAT or ACT), letters of recommendation, a statement of purpose, and sometimes a portfolio showcasing your coding projects. Ensure that you fulfill all the requirements and prepare your application well in advance.

3. Writing a Compelling Statement of Purpose

The statement of purpose (SOP) is a crucial part of your application. It allows you to showcase your passion for computer science, highlight your academic and extracurricular achievements, and explain why you are a suitable candidate for the program. Craft a compelling SOP that demonstrates your unique perspective, future goals, and how studying abroad aligns with your aspirations.

4. Preparing for Standardized Tests

Many universities require standardized test scores, such as the SAT or ACT, as part of the application process. Familiarize yourself with the test format, practice sample questions, and consider taking preparatory courses or hiring a tutor if necessary. Dedicate sufficient time to prepare for the tests to maximize your chances of achieving a competitive score.

5. Gathering Strong Letters of Recommendation

Letters of recommendation provide insights into your academic abilities and personal qualities. Choose recommenders who know you well and can speak to your strengths as a computer science student. Provide them with sufficient information about your achievements and goals to help them write compelling and personalized letters of recommendation.

Financing Your Computer Science Studies Abroad

Studying abroad comes with financial considerations. In this section, we will discuss various scholarships, grants, and other funding opportunities specifically tailored for computer science students. Learn how to make your study abroad experience financially feasible.

READ :  Everything You Need to Know About Computer Charging Carts

1. Scholarships and Grants

Many universities and organizations offer scholarships and grants specifically for computer science students. Research and identify scholarships that align with your profile and academic achievements. Pay attention to deadlines and application requirements, and prepare compelling scholarship essays or statements to maximize your chances of securing funding.

2. Research Assistantships and Teaching Assistantships

Some universities offer research assistantships or teaching assistantships that provide financial support in exchange for assisting professors with research or teaching responsibilities. Explore opportunities to work with professors in your field of interest and inquire about assistantship opportunities within the computer science department.

3. Part-Time Jobs and Internships

Consider seeking part-time jobs or internships while studying abroad to supplement your income. Look for internships or part-time positions in tech companies or start-ups that provide hands-on experience in the field of computer science. These opportunities not only provide financial support but also enhance your practical skills and industry exposure.

4. Crowdfunding and Fundraising

If you are passionate about studying computer science abroad but face financial constraints, consider exploring crowdfunding platforms or organizing fundraising events. Engage your network of family, friends, and potential sponsors to support your educational journey. Craft a compelling campaign highlighting your aspirations and the value you will bring to the field of computer science.

Adapting to a New Environment: Culture Shock and Beyond

Adjusting to a new environment can be challenging, especially when it involves a different culture and language. This section will provide insights on dealing with culture shock, tips for adapting to a new lifestyle, and ways to make the most of your study abroad experience.

1. Dealing with Culture Shock1. Dealing with Culture Shock

Culture shock is a common experience when studying abroad. It’s the feeling of disorientation and unease that arises from being in a new and unfamiliar cultural environment. To navigate culture shock effectively, it’s essential to be open-minded and adaptable. Embrace the differences in language, customs, and social norms, and try to learn as much as you can about the local culture before your departure. Engage in cultural exchange activities, such as language exchanges or joining local clubs and organizations, to foster understanding and build connections with locals.

2. Adapting to a New Lifestyle

Adapting to a new lifestyle in a foreign country requires flexibility and a willingness to step outside your comfort zone. Embrace the local way of life, whether it’s adjusting to different eating habits, transportation systems, or social norms. Take the opportunity to explore the city or region where you’re studying, immerse yourself in local traditions, and try new experiences. Building a routine that balances your academic commitments with leisure and cultural activities will help you settle into your new environment more smoothly.

3. Making the Most of Your Study Abroad Experience

Studying abroad is not just about academics; it’s also about personal growth and enrichment. To make the most of your study abroad experience, step outside the boundaries of your university and explore the wider community. Engage in volunteer work, participate in local events and festivals, and travel to nearby cities or countries during your free time. Take advantage of the opportunities provided by your host university, such as cultural excursions, language courses, or clubs and societies related to computer science. These activities will enrich your experience, broaden your perspective, and create lasting memories.

Exploring Internship and Job Opportunities

Studying computer science abroad not only enhances your academic knowledge but also opens doors to exciting internship and job opportunities. Discover how studying abroad can help you build a global professional network and increase your chances of securing internships or employment in the field of computer science.

1. Leveraging University Career Services

Many universities abroad have dedicated career services departments that offer support and resources for students seeking internships or job placements. These departments provide guidance on resume writing, interview preparation, and connecting with potential employers. Take advantage of these services to enhance your employability and seek advice on local internship or job opportunities.

2. Networking with Industry Professionals

Networking is key to securing internships and job opportunities, both in your home country and abroad. Attend career fairs, industry events, and tech conferences to connect with professionals in the field of computer science. Join relevant professional organizations or online communities to expand your network and stay updated with industry trends. Engage in conversations, seek mentorship, and explore collaboration opportunities that can open doors to internships or job offers.

3. Internships and Co-op Programs

Many universities abroad have partnerships with local companies and offer internship or co-op programs specifically for international students. These programs provide valuable hands-on experience in the field of computer science and can enhance your resume. Research and inquire about internship opportunities within your host country and leverage your university’s network to secure placements that align with your interests and career goals.

4. Showcasing Study Abroad Experience on Your Resume

Studying computer science abroad is a unique experience that can make your resume stand out to potential employers. Highlight your study abroad experience by showcasing the skills, knowledge, and cultural adaptability you gained during your time abroad. Emphasize any international projects, research, or collaborations you were involved in, as well as any language skills you acquired or enhanced. Frame your study abroad experience as a valuable asset that sets you apart from other candidates in the competitive job market.

Networking and Collaboration in the Computer Science Community

Networking and collaboration are crucial in the world of computer science. This section will highlight the importance of building connections within the international computer science community, including participating in conferences, joining professional organizations, and leveraging online platforms.

1. Participating in Conferences and Tech Events

Attending conferences and tech events is an excellent way to network, learn from experts, and stay up-to-date with the latest advancements in the field of computer science. Look for international conferences or events in your host country or neighboring regions and try to secure funding or scholarships to attend. Engage in discussions, present your research or projects, and interact with professionals and peers who share your passion for computer science.

2. Joining Professional Organizations

Joining professional organizations related to computer science allows you to connect with like-minded individuals and stay informed about industry developments. Research international organizations such as the Association for Computing Machinery (ACM) or the Institute of Electrical and Electronics Engineers (IEEE) and consider becoming a member. Attend local chapter events or join online forums to network, share knowledge, and collaborate with professionals from around the world.

3. Leveraging Online Platforms

The digital age has provided numerous online platforms for networking and collaboration in the computer science community. Utilize platforms like LinkedIn, GitHub, or Stack Overflow to showcase your skills, connect with professionals, and collaborate on open-source projects. Engage in online discussions, contribute to relevant forums, and leverage these platforms to build a strong online presence that reflects your expertise and passion for computer science.

Immersion in Local Tech Culture and Innovation

One of the greatest advantages of studying computer science abroad is immersing yourself in the local tech culture and innovation. This section will delve into the ways you can engage with the local tech community, attend tech events, and explore innovative projects during your time abroad.

1. Engaging with Local Tech Start-ups

Tech start-ups are often at the forefront of innovation in a country or region. Research and identify local tech start-ups in your host country that align with your interests or areas of expertise. Reach out to these start-ups and inquire about opportunities to visit their offices, attend networking events, or even intern or work part-time. Engaging with start-ups allows you to witness innovation firsthand and gain insights into the local tech ecosystem.

2. Attending Tech Meetups and Hackathons

Tech meetups and hackathons are popular events in the tech community, providing opportunities to network, collaborate, and showcase your skills. Research local tech meetups and hackathons in your host country and participate in these events. Collaborate with other participants on projects, exchange knowledge, and immerse yourself in the local tech culture. These events not only expand your network but also sharpen your problem-solving abilities and expose you to cutting-edge technologies.

3. Collaborating with Local Researchers or Professors

Reach out to local researchers or professors in your host university who are conducting research in areas of your interest. Express your enthusiasm and inquire about opportunities to collaborate on research projects or assist with ongoing studies. Collaborating with local researchers not only enhances your academic experience but also exposes you to the latest advancements and research practices in the country.

Return on Investment: Career Prospects and Future Opportunities

Studying computer science abroad can have a significant impact on your future career prospects. This section will discuss the long-term benefits of studying abroad, including increased employability, global perspectives, and the potential for future collaborations and entrepreneurship.

1. Increased Employability

Studying computer science abroad demonstrates your adaptability, cultural awareness, and ability to thrive in diverse environments. These qualities are highly valued by employers in the global tech industry. The international experience and the skills you acquired during your study abroad journey set you apart from other candidates and increase your chances of securing attractive job opportunities, both locally and internationally.

2. Global Perspectives and Cultural Intelligence

Studying abroad provides you with a global perspective and cultural intelligence, which are vital in our interconnected world. Having an understanding of different cultures and working styles allows you to collaborate effectively with colleagues from diverse backgrounds. Your ability to navigate cultural nuances and adapt to different work environments gives you a competitive edge in the global job market.

3. Future Collaborations and Entrepreneurship

Building a global network through your study abroad experience opens doors for future collaborations and potential entrepreneurship opportunities. The connections you establish with peers, professors, and professionals from around the world can lead to joint research projects, start-up ventures, or even international consulting opportunities. Embrace these possibilities and nurture the relationships you formed during your time abroad to unlock future career prospects.

In conclusion, studying computer science abroad is an invaluable opportunity to broaden your knowledge, gain an international perspective, and enhance your career prospects. By immersing yourself in a new culture and educational environment, you can truly master your computer science skills while building lifelong connections. Start your journey today and unlock a world of possibilities in the field of computer science!

Billy L. Wood

Unlocking the Wonders of Technology: Unveils the Secrets!

Related Post

Leave a Comment